delhibreakings delhi rohini sector 32 laborer death open manhole Delhi Rohini Incident: Laborer Dies After Falling into 14-Foot Deep Open Manhole

A 32-year-old laborer died after falling into an open sewer manhole in Rohini Sector 32 on Monday evening. The victim, identified as Birju Kumar Rai, was a native of Bihar working in Delhi. The incident took place on a vacant DDA plot near the Mahashakti Kali Mandir. Police recovered the body on Tuesday afternoon following a report by the victim’s friend.

Why was the incident reported late?

The incident occurred around 7:30 PM on February 9, but the police received the call only at 2:36 PM the next day. Birju was with his friend Budhan Das at the time of the fall. Police statements suggest that both were intoxicated while returning to their jhuggi. Budhan did not inform anyone immediately because of his state. He only notified another friend on Tuesday after realizing what had happened.

What action has been taken by the authorities?

  • FIR Registration: The Delhi Police at Begumpur Station filed an FIR for criminal negligence against unknown persons.
  • DDA Action: Officials from the Delhi Development Authority covered the 14-foot-deep manhole shortly after the body was retrieved.
  • Rescue Details: The Delhi Fire Services conducted the operation for several hours to pull the body out of the narrow 2-foot-wide opening.
  • Recent Context: This is the second death due to civic negligence in Delhi within a single week following a similar accident in Janakpuri.
